It is well known that smooth muscles of the airway and bladder undergo length adaptation while under persistent contraction. This adaptation process comprises a remodelling of the intracellular actin and myosin filaments, which results in a shift of the peak of the active force-length curve towards the length at which the adaptation is taking place.

How is smooth muscle controlled?

They lack the striated banding pattern present in cardiac and skeletal muscle, and they are innervated by the autonomic nervous system, which is responsible for controlling the body’s functions. Smooth muscle contraction is also influenced by hormones, autocrine/paracrine agents, and other chemical signals that are present in the surrounding environment.

What is the function of smooth muscle cell?

Smooth muscle cells are very variable in their appearance and function depending on the organ system in which they are found. One of their primary functions is to regulate the diameter, wall movement, and wall stiffness of hollow organs, such as those of the cardiovascular, bronchial, digestive, or urogenital systems, as well as the uterine.

What are the special features of the smooth muscle?

Smooth muscle, also known as involuntary muscle, is a kind of muscle that does not display cross stripes when examined under a microscope. It is composed of slender spindle-shaped cells with a single nucleus that is placed in the center of the cell. The contraction of smooth muscle tissue is slower and more automatic than that of striated muscle.

Why are smooth muscles involuntary?

Smooth muscle does not respond to voluntary commands and is hence referred to as involuntary muscle. Smooth muscle contraction is triggered by a variety of reasons, including hormones, neurological activation via the autonomic nervous system, and local variables.

Which is functional unit of smooth muscle?

Introduction. Smooth muscle tissue differs significantly from the other kinds of muscle tissue in terms of its structural organization. The smooth muscle myocyte (Myocytus nonstriatus) is the fundamental structural and functional unit of smooth muscle. It is distinguished by its unique structure, organization, and innervation.

How does smooth muscle differ from skeletal muscle quizlet?

What is the difference between smooth muscle and skeletal muscle? Smooth muscle contains a less amount of sarcoplasmic reticulum. T tubules are absent from smooth muscle. Myosin heads can be seen along the whole length of smooth muscle thick filaments.

What is the function of the smooth muscle cell?

A variety of functions are performed, including closing orifices (such as the pylorus and uterine os) and transporting chyme down the intestinal tube by means of wavelike contractions. Smooth muscle cells contract at a slower rate than skeletal muscle cells, but they are stronger, more sustained, and need less energy than skeletal muscle cells.
